Morgane de toi is the sixth studio album from French artist Renaud, recorded in Canoga Park, Los Angeles, California, with American session musicians.
It remains one of Renaud's most successful albums to date, including two of his most famous songs, the sea tale "Dès que le vent soufflera" and the ballad "Morgane de toi", about his daughter Lolita.
Tracks 1, 4 and 9 are all used on the live album Visage pâle rencontrer public.
Tracks 1, 4 and 6 were included on the compilation The Meilleur of Renaud (75-85).
Tracks 1, 2, 4 and 6 were covered for the tribute album La Bande à Renaud.
